Is there an emergency trunk release inside the trunk on an '03 STR? If so try this
Since you can get in the vehicle, fold down the rear seat arm rest, there is a small opening. Grab a flashlight and "rig" up a long hook and give a pull. The pull handle maybe located on the upper portion of the trunk.

I understood the valet key will not open the glove box. Right?
(I thought they also didn't open the trunk.)
Is your valet key like that?
And... is your new key able to open everything?
If so, they must have programmed it into the car. Doing that removes all other keys. Anyone with the old keys would be able to turn the locks (so, open doors etc) but the car would not start.
